次の方法で共有


Assembly.GetManifestResourceStream メソッド (Type, String)

このアセンブリから、指定された型の名前空間によってスコープが指定されている、指定されたマニフェスト リソースを読み込みます。

Overloads Public Overridable Function GetManifestResourceStream( _
   ByVal type As Type, _   ByVal name As String _) As Stream
[C#]
public virtual Stream GetManifestResourceStream(Typetype,stringname);
[C++]
public: virtual Stream* GetManifestResourceStream(Type* type,String* name);
[JScript]
public function GetManifestResourceStream(
   type : Type,name : String) : Stream;

パラメータ

  • type
    マニフェスト リソース名のスコープを指定するために名前空間を使用する型。
  • name
    要求されているマニフェスト リソースの名前。

戻り値

マニフェスト リソースを表す Stream

例外

例外の種類 条件
ArgumentNullException name パラメータが null 参照 (Visual Basic では Nothing) です。
ArgumentException name パラメータが空の文字列 ("") です。
SecurityException 呼び出し元に、必要なアクセス許可がありません。

解説

このメソッドは、パブリック リソースとプライベート リソースのどちらに対しても機能します。

使用例

type の完全名が "MyNameSpace.MyClasses" で、name が "Net" の場合、 GetManifestResourceStream は、MyNameSpace.Net という名前のリソースを検索します。

必要条件

プラットフォーム: Windows 98, Windows NT 4.0, Windows Millennium Edition, Windows 2000, Windows XP Home Edition, Windows XP Professional, Windows Server 2003 ファミリ, .NET Compact Framework - Windows CE .NET

.NET Framework セキュリティ:

参照

Assembly クラス | Assembly メンバ | System.Reflection 名前空間 | Assembly.GetManifestResourceStream オーバーロードの一覧 | アセンブリ マニフェスト